Using Quote Templates for Repeat Jobs

Save quote configurations as templates and apply them to new quotes for faster quoting on repeat work.

If you regularly quote similar jobs — phone cases, lithophanes, brackets — templates save you from re-entering the same line items every time.

Creating a Template

There are two ways to create a template:

  • From an existing quote — open any quote and click Save as Template. The line items, markup, notes, and terms are saved as a reusable template.
  • From the Templates page — go to Templates in the sidebar and click New Template. Build the template from scratch with your standard line items and settings.

Using a Template

When creating a new quote, select a template from the dropdown at the top of the form. The template's line items, markup, notes, and terms are pre-filled into the new quote. You can then modify anything before saving.

Managing Templates

The Templates page shows all your saved templates with their line item count and last used date. Edit or delete templates as your product offerings change.

Template Ideas

  • "Standard PLA Print" — generic line items for typical PLA jobs
  • "Rush Order (+50%)" — higher markup and expedited delivery terms
  • "Multi-Part Assembly" — multiple line items for assembly projects
  • "Design + Print Package" — design fee + printing + post-processing
